Briefly

The Bavarian Podcast Works Show dives into recent developments regarding Bayern Munich and the German national team. Leon Goretzka is expected to play a significant role for Germany against Portugal, showcasing his importance. Additionally, there are reports of Julian Nagelsmann being very close to returning to Bayern Munich, although details remain scarce. The show discusses Bayern's potential need for reinforcements at left wing, considering players like Rafael Leão and Cody Gakpo. Lastly, it reflects on the cautionary tales of managing young talents like Timo Werner and Jadon Sancho's career decisions.
